Lateral movement of radioactivity from [(14)C]gibberellic acid (GA 3) in roots and coleoptiles of Zea mays L. seedlings during geotropic stimulation.

J H Webster1, M B Wilkins.   

Abstract

An upward lateral movement of radioactivity from [(14)C]gibberellic acid (GA3) has been found to occur in geotropically stimulated coleoptiles and primary roots of intact Zea mays (L.) seedlings.
